About

Trained at the Scuola Normale Superiore in Pisa (Italy), the Ecole Normale Supérieure (Paris and Lyon, France), the University of Salento (Lecce, Italy), and the Ernst-Moritz-Arndt-Universität in Greifswald (Germany), I have been working for several years on Nietzsche's philosophy (ethics, aesthetics, and philosophical psychology) and on contemporary sociology. In addition, I have dealt with questions concerning the relationship between knowledge and belief - especially religious belief - in the thought of Pascal, Kierkegaard and Wittgenstein. More recently, I have focused my research on the philosophy and sociology of love and love relationships in contemporary Western society. I also work on gender issues, philosophical anthropology, and film philosophy.
